I have a .223 N.E.F. For the money, it can't be beat. It's light weight for carrying if you have a long walk. The only bug is the ejector. You have to take care when loading. If the shell doen't catch on the ejector, it will stick in the chamber after firing.
I called up and shot a double last year with mine. The coyotes were only about 30 yards away. After the first one hit the ground, the second couldn't figure out where the shot came from. I had time to reload and get the second one too.
